Expressions of interest are now being invited for students in Years 8 to 10 across the Sunshine Coast to take part in the Mayor’s Telstra Innovation Masterclass Series.

Sunshine Coast Council has launched the new program in partnership with Telstra and Study Sunshine Coast.

The series builds on the success of the Mayor's Telstra Innovation Awards program and will provide even greater access and opportunities for local students.

Sunshine Coast Mayor Rosanna Natoli praised the initiative.

“The Mayor’s Telstra Innovation Masterclass Series is a fantastic opportunity for our young people to learn from the best and be inspired to achieve great things,” Mayor Natoli said.

“We are committed to investing in our youth and providing them with the tools they need to succeed.

“By supporting our students and connecting them with industry leaders, we are not only helping them to achieve their dreams but also ensuring the continued growth and prosperity of the region.

“Supporting innovation is so important for the region and aligns with Council’s advocacy priorities to cement the Sunshine Coast as one of Australia’s most advanced economies, anchored by technology and innovation.”

Students will dive into essential topics like leadership, critical and creative thinking and industry connections.

The first Masterclass, to be held on June 4 at Altitude Nine, Maroochydore, will be themed around ‘Future Leaders’.

Insights from world record pilot

The masterclass will be delivered by Lachie Smart a world record pilot, top Australian emerging leadership speaker and CEO of Smartline Medical, based on the Sunshine Coast.

When Lachie was just 18 years old, he became the youngest person to fly solo around the world in a single-engine aircraft.

Now an in-demand speaker, Lachie said he had developed this masterclass specifically for young people to enable them to realise their potential.

“I’m super excited to bring the Future Leaders Workshop to the Sunshine Coast. We have some exciting things in store,” Mr Smart said.

Telstra Regional Engagement Manager Matt Thornton said he was proud to support the program.

“We aim to educate the students, not only about technology and innovation, entrepreneurship and business skills, but also have them understand that world-class ideas and businesses don’t have to be based in major cities to be successful,” Mr Thornton said.

How students can apply

The Masterclass Series is open to Sunshine Coast students in Years 8 to 10.

Places are limited and participation is by Expression of Interest (EOI). 

Interested students are encouraged to apply via www.studysunshinecoast.com.au or speak to their school coordinator.

EOI Opens: Wednesday, April 30
EOI Closes: Friday, May 9
Successful Applicants Notified: Monday, May 12
First Masterclass Event: Wednesday, June 4

Each selected participant will receive a certificate of participation, and a Telstra tech goodie bag.
